SAP UI5 表格 Click to Select 文本的来源

简介: SAP UI5 表格 Click to Select 文本的来源

如下图所示,文本来源:sap/ui/table 下的 messagebundle_en_US.properties 文件内。


image.png


SAP UI5是一款用于开发企业级Web应用程序的框架,messagebundle_en_US.properties 是SAP UI5中用于国际化的资源文件之一。



messagebundle_en_US.properties文件中包含了SAP UI5应用程序中用到的所有文本信息的键值对,其中键是一个字符串,代表应用程序中使用的文本标识符,值则是该文本标识符所对应的文本内容,通常是英文。在SAP UI5应用程序中,可以通过指定文本标识符来获取该文本标识符所对应的文本内容,从而实现应用程序的国际化支持。为了支持不同的语言版本,开发人员需要为每种语言编写一个对应的资源文件,例如messagebundle_zh_CN.properties文件用于中文(简体)语言环境。


需要注意的是,在SAP UI5应用程序中,通常会使用多个不同的资源文件来实现不同的功能和页面,每个资源文件都会包含与之相关的文本信息。开发人员需要根据应用程序中使用到的不同文本信息来选择合适的资源文件,从而实现应用程序的国际化支持。


用什么工具可以生成 messagebundle_en_US.properties 文件?


messagebundle_en_US.properties文件通常是由开发人员手动创建和维护的。在创建messagebundle_en_US.properties文件时,可以使用任何文本编辑器,如记事本、Sublime Text、Notepad++等。开发人员可以按照Java属性文件的格式编写文本信息,即使用键值对的方式将应用程序中使用的文本标识符与文本内容进行映射。例如:


  • welcomeMessage=Welcome to my application!
  • submitButton=Submit
  • cancelButton=Cancel

以上是messagebundle_en_US.properties文件的一个示例,其中包含了三个键值对,分别对应应用程序中的三个文本标识符及其对应的文本内容。


另外,有些集成开发环境(IDE)或SAP UI5应用程序的开发工具,如SAP Web IDE、Eclipse等,也提供了一些方便的工具和插件来辅助开发人员创建和管理国际化资源文件。例如,在SAP Web IDE中,开发人员可以使用i18n资源编辑器来创建和编辑多语言资源文件,包括messagebundle_en_US.properties文件。



相关文章
|
5月前
【UI】 element -ui select下拉框label显示多个值
【UI】 element -ui select下拉框label显示多个值
153 1
|
5月前
【UI】elementui select点击获取label 和 value
【UI】elementui select点击获取label 和 value
30 1
|
JavaScript 前端开发 数据处理
【React/Vue2】 使用Element UI 高度封装Select 下拉框创建条目(Ant Design更为简单)
【React/Vue2】 使用Element UI 高度封装Select 下拉框创建条目(Ant Design更为简单)
【React/Vue2】 使用Element UI 高度封装Select 下拉框创建条目(Ant Design更为简单)
|
JavaScript UED
解决 Element-ui中 选择器(Select)因options 数据量大导致渲染慢、页面卡顿的问题
解决 Element-ui中 选择器(Select)因options 数据量大导致渲染慢、页面卡顿的问题
3502 0
解决 Element-ui中 选择器(Select)因options 数据量大导致渲染慢、页面卡顿的问题
|
JSON JavaScript 前端开发
用 SAP UI5 Select 控件(下拉列表),来驱动表格控件(Table)刷新的一个实战例子试读版
用 SAP UI5 Select 控件(下拉列表),来驱动表格控件(Table)刷新的一个实战例子试读版
|
Web App开发 前端开发 JavaScript
SAP UI5 应用开发教程之九十五 - SAP UI5 下拉菜单(Select) 控件的使用方式试读版
SAP UI5 应用开发教程之九十五 - SAP UI5 下拉菜单(Select) 控件的使用方式试读版
|
移动开发 HTML5
Element-ui中 选择器(select)多选下拉框实现全选功能
Element-ui中 选择器(select)多选下拉框实现全选功能
830 0
Element-ui中 选择器(select)多选下拉框实现全选功能
|
JavaScript
|
JavaScript 前端开发
Vue注册自定义指令实现element-ui组件库select下拉框滚动加载更多
Vue注册自定义指令实现element-ui组件库select下拉框滚动加载更多
374 0
Vue注册自定义指令实现element-ui组件库select下拉框滚动加载更多
|
前端开发 JavaScript Java
Struts2的%,#,$的区别,UI标签及其表单radio,checkbox,select回显数据(七)上
Struts2的%,#,$的区别,UI标签及其表单radio,checkbox,select回显数据(七)
165 0
Struts2的%,#,$的区别,UI标签及其表单radio,checkbox,select回显数据(七)上
下一篇
无影云桌面